Step back in time with this 1874 folk Victorian home. Known as “The Heard House”, this 6 bedroom, 3 bath two-story home can easily be a wonderful family home or Bed and Breakfast. The full-length porch is supported by square columns and has flat jigsaw cut trim and spindle work railing. Upon entering the double entry door, you will find a grand foyer with extra high ceilings and beautiful crown moldings. French doors lead to an open deck, covered back porch and fenced backyard. The four large bedrooms on the lower floor each have their own fireplace with detailed mantels. Two upstairs bedrooms flank each side of a large landing and bathroom. Located just minutes from historic downtown Marshall which hosts many annual events including the Fire Ant Festival, Wonderland of Lights, Market on the Square, Taco Fest and more. Marshall has close proximity to area lakes including Caddo Lake, Lake O’ The Pines and Martin Creek Lake and is conveniently located near Interstate 20 for easy commuting to Shreveport, Longview and Tyler.
